Meaning, origin, history

Omari is a unique and distinctive name of African origin, particularly from the Fulani people who are predominantly found in Nigeria, Cameroon, Niger, and other West African countries. The name Omari has two parts: "Omar" which means "life" or "long-lived," and "i," which signifies "my." Therefore, Omari translates to "my life." The name has a rich history, dating back to the ancient Fulani people who used it as one of their traditional names. Over time, Omari has gained popularity beyond its African roots and is now recognized globally. It's not uncommon to find people named Omari in various parts of the world today. Omari is also a name that has made headlines in popular culture. For instance, Omari Hardwick, an American actor known for his role in the television series "Power," bears this unique name.
